Enhancing bass (Bass Booster)
You can enhance bass sounds that are often
muted by driving noise.
1 Display the “Audio” screen.
Ü
For details, refer to
Customizing the audio
settings
on page 59.
2 Tap or next to “Bass Booster” to
adjust the range from 0 to +6.
Using the high pass filter
When you cut lower sounds from the subwoof-
er output frequency, activate “
High Pass Fil-
ter
”. Only frequencies higher than those in the
selected range are output from the front or
rear speakers.
1 Display the “Audio” screen.
Ü
For details, refer to
Customizing the audio
settings
on page 59.
2 Tap or next to “High Pass Filter”.
Each time you tap or
,
cut-off frequen-
cies are selected in the following order:
Off
(default) —
50Hz
—
63Hz
—
80Hz
—
100Hz
—
125Hz
Adjusting source levels
“
Source Level Adjuster
” lets you adjust the
volume level of each source to prevent radical
changes in volume when switching between
the sources.
❐
Settings are based on the FM volume level,
which remains unchanged.
1 Play the source you want to adjust the
volume level for.
The adjustable sources are “
iPod
”, “
Apps
”,
“
MirrorLink
”, “
Pandora
”, “
Bluetooth
”,
“
DVD-V
”, “
CD
”, “
ROM
” and “
AM
” band.
2 Display the “Audio” screen.
Ü
For details, refer to
Customizing the audio
settings
on page 59.
3 Tap [Source Level Adjuster].
The “
Source Level Adjuster
” screen ap-
pears.
4 Tap or to adjust the source vol-
ume.
“
+4
” to “
–4
” is displayed as the source vol-
ume is increased or decreased.
